The Evidence Intake Center (EIC) is a VA office in Janesville, Wisconsin, that processes documents related to VA disability compensation. The VA requires veterans to send all paperwork to this centralized office rather than requiring them to send documents to various regional offices (RO).

The original VA hospital in Salt Lake City, located at 12th Avenue and E Street, admitted its first patient on July 5, 1932.
If you need assistance obtaining your military records, then contact any County Veteran Service Officer (CVSO). To obtain your DD-214 on your own, submit your request via the National Archives and Records Administration webpage or call 314-801-0800.
